Whiskey Sour
2 oz blended whiskey
Juice of 1/2 lemon
1/2 tsp powdered sugar
1 cherry
1/2 slice lemon
Shake blended whiskey, juice of lemon, and powdered sugar with ice and strain into a whiskey sour glass. Decorate with the half-slice of lemon, top with the cherry, and serve.

Someone posted that we can claim Placebo, AC/DC etc. because of their Scottish members.
By that rationale, Talking Heads (Byrne born in Dumbarton), The KLF (Bill Drummond) and The Faces (Rod Stewart) all count by having Scots members.
Thin Lizzy had Scotsman Brian Robertson, Snow Patrol has Tom Simpson and Colin Hay, lead singer from Men At Work was born in Ayrshire.
